Transaction d69585a2604e62a3c2cbc5c3351e28fc77dc0eebc550f3fdc3b4c071728a7363
1 Input
2 Outputs
- d69585a2604e62a3c2cbc5c3351e28fc77dc0eebc550f3fdc3b4c071728a7363:0
- d69585a2604e62a3c2cbc5c3351e28fc77dc0eebc550f3fdc3b4c071728a7363:1
value 28532
address 1B7szra2SgoynjtxJBjk5LJrQQxvEwkGok
value 6708164
address 3HQKezQGNAEAxM1ThfRi5vH8HtkwDYD5Jh